Jain University BA fee during admission is one-time fee. The range of the one-time fee is 500 to 30 K. The total BA tuition fee at Jain University ranges between 27 K and 13 L. The exact amount depends on selected specialisation. The fee information is sourced from the official website of the institute/sanctioning body. It is subject to change and hence, is indicative.

Seats of preparatory courses in IITs vary from year to year and are done on the number of vacant reserved category seats remaining after general admissions. The preparatory courses aim at serving SC, ST and PwD applicants who could not reach the marks qualifying them but who have a promise. There are no specified number of seats in the preparatory course but will depend on available vacancies every year. For the most accurate and up-to-date information, it is advisable to visit the official Joint Seat Allocation Authority (JoSAA) website or the respective IITs' admissions websites.

The BA courses at Jain University are offered at the undergraduate level. To be eligible for these courses, candidates must have passed Class 12 in Science, Arts or Commerce from PUC/ISC/CBSE or an equivalent recognised board. Additionally, the candidates must apply for the Jain Entrance Test (JET) conducted by the university. Admissions to the BA courses of Jain University are based on the performance in JET written test and Personal Interview (PI) round.

Yes, BA is available at Jain University as a UG-level course. The duration of Jain University BA courses is either three or four years, depending upon the choice of specialisation. Applicants can choose between a BA (Programme), BA (Hons), BA (Hons with Research) and BA (Professional). Admission to these courses is based on the scores of JET i.e. Jain Entrance Test. Some of the specialisations of BA offered at Jain University include BA (Psychology, Sociology, Economics), BA (Hons) in Economics, BA (Optional English, Psychology, Journalism), BA (Professional) in Journalism & Mass Communication, etc.

No, candidates will not get a duplicate admit card at the exam centre. They must bring the printed Regional Institute of Education Common Entrance Examination (RIE CEE) admit card issued by the exam body - National Council of Educational Research & Training (NCERT).
